A Unique Way to Discover Versailles
This tour promises more than just a drive; it’s a curated journey into the heart of Versailles’ exterior architectural marvels and lush park areas. You’ll start right in front of the Versailles City Hall on 4 Avenue de Paris, a convenient central location that acts as a gateway to the historic streets.
From there, your guide, Virginie—who’s been a resident of Versailles for over 20 years—takes you on a route along the Avenue de Paris, facing the Palace. Her local knowledge and storytelling prowess truly shine as she shares stories about the city’s famous residents and hidden tales from the 17th and 18th centuries. The mention of her “allowing you to learn that Versailles is so much more than the castle” highlights how this tour offers a fuller picture of the city’s history.
Exploring the Districts
The tour first meanders through the Saint-Louis and Notre-Dame districts, two areas brimming with history and charming architecture. These neighborhoods, often overlooked in standard visits, are rich in stories about the everyday lives of past residents and the evolution of the city.
Park and Estate Highlights
The big draw is the extended park visit, where you’ll see the Petit Trianon, Grand Trianon, and Grand Canal from the outside. These iconic sites give you a glimpse into the private retreats of French royalty—Marie-Antoinette’s sanctuary, for instance—without the crowds of inside visits. The drink break in the park adds a relaxed touch, allowing you to soak in the scenery or snap photos without feeling rushed.

For $211, this tour packs a lot of value. You get a private guide, a 2-hour vintage car ride, and entrance to the park of the Palace. The drink break in the park adds a charming touch, making the experience feel more like a leisurely outing rather than a rushed tour.
However, it’s important to note that your ticket to the Palace interior isn’t included. This is purely an exterior exploration of the estate, so if visiting inside the palace or gardens is on your list, you’ll need to arrange separate tickets.
The pick-up service—offered free of charge—adds convenience, particularly if you’re staying within Versailles. Just remember, pets, food, and drinks in the vehicle are not allowed, so plan accordingly.

Is this tour suitable for children?
No, it’s not recommended for children under 10, as the focus is on relaxed sightseeing and storytelling suitable for mature guests.
Does this tour include entry to the Palace?
No, the tour only covers the exterior of the Palace, Trianon estate, and park. Separate tickets are needed if you want inside access.
Can I be picked up from my hotel?
Yes, complimentary pick-up at your hotel or train station in Versailles is included, making logistics easier.
How long is the tour?
The experience lasts around 2 hours, which is enough to see key outdoor sights without feeling rushed.
